What is hex #737D99 Color?

Rhythm (Hex code: 737D99) Thumbnail

The color name of hex code #737D99 is Rhythm. The RGB values are (115, 125, 153) which means it is composed of 29% red, 32% green and 39% blue. The CMYK color codes, used in printers, are C:25 M:18 Y:0 K:40. In the HSV/HSB scale, #737D99 has a hue of 224°, 25% saturation and a brightness value of 60%.

Complementary Palette

The complement of #737D99 is #998F73 which is called Artichoke. Complementary colors are those found at the opposite ends of the color wheel. Thus, as per the RGB system, the best contrast to #737D99 color is offered by #998F73. The complementary color palette is easiest to use and work with. Studies have shown that contrasting color palette is the best way to grab a viewer's attention.

Analogous Palette

The analogous colors of #737D99 are #7C7399 and #739099, called Rhythm and Light Slate Gray, respectively. In the RGB color wheel, they are located to the right and left of #737D99 with a 30° separation. An analogous color palette is extremely soothing to the eyes and works wonders if your main color is soft or pastel.

Split-Complementary Palette

As per the RGB color wheel, the split-complementary colors of #737D99 are #997C73 (Burnished Brown) and #909973 (Artichoke). A split-complementary color palette consists of the main color along with those on either side (30°) of the complementary color. Based on our research, usage of split-complementary palettes is on the rise online, especially in graphics and web sites designs. It may be because it is not as contrasting as the complementary color palette and, hence, results in a combination which is pleasant to the eyes.

Triadic Palette

#737D99 triadic color palette has three colors each of which is separated by 120° in the RGB wheel. Thus, #99737D (Bazaar) and #7D9973 (Oxley) along with #737D99, our main color, create a stunning and beautiful triadic palette with the maximum variation in hue and, therefore, offering the best possible contrast when taken together.
